<h3>Answer:   5(x+7)</h3>

Explanation:

We'll use the distributive rule in reverse

5x+35 = 5*x + 5*7 = 5(x+7)

In general, the distributive rule is a*(b+c) = a*b+a*c. We multiply the outer term 'a' by each term inside the parenthesis.

When going from 5(x+7) to 5x+35, we multiply the outer 5 by each of the terms inside.
